You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end University of California - San Diego. It ranked #1 on our 2023 Best Value Structural Engineering Schools in California For Those Making $75-$110k list. La Jolla, California is the setting for this large institution of higher learning. The public school handed out ’s structural engineering degrees to 191 students in 2020-2021.

UCSD also made our “Best Structural Engineering Schools in California” list, coming in at #2. It costs about $20,906 for California Structural Engineering students whose families make $75-$110k per year to attend UCSD.

With a freshman retention rate of 94%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its undergraduate students. The undergrad student loan default rate at the school is 1.0%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end California State University - Northridge. The school came in at #2 for the Best Value Structural Engineering Schools in California For Those Making $75-$110k. CSUN is a large public school situated in Northridge, California. It awarded 18 ’s structural engineering degrees in 2020-2021.

CSUN did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#3 on our “Best Structural Engineering Schools in California” list. It costs about $15,380 for California Structural Engineering students whose families make $75-$110k per year to attend California State University - Northridge.

The undergrad student loan default rate at the school is 3.7%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.

Out of the 3 schools in the Best Value Structural Engineering Schools in California For Those Making $75-$110k that were part of this year’s ranking, University of Southern California landed the #3 spot on the list. University of Southern California is a large school located in Los Angeles, California that handed out 40 ’s structural engineering degrees in 2020-2021.

USC also made our “Best Structural Engineering Schools in California” list, coming in at #1. The yearly cost to attend USC is $32,363 for California Structural Engineering students whose families make $75-$110k.

The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 91%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year. The undergraduate student-to-faculty ratio of 9 to 1 is a sign that students will have more opportunities to engage with their professors one-on-one. The undergrad student loan default rate at the school is 1.3%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.
